Verst to Hectometer Conversion Formula

One verst is equal to 10.668 hectometer.

Manual Calculation to Convert 40 verst to hm

To convert 40 verst to hectometer, multiply the value by the conversion factor: 10.668. As one verst is equal to 10.668 hectometer, therefore,

40 verst x 10.668 = 426.72 hectometer

So, 40 verst = 426.72 hectometer
